Hi:
I am using GNU Emacs 21.2.1 (powerpc-apple-darwin, X toolkit) of
2006-03-22.
I am trying to turn on by default flyspell-mode. To do this, I added
in my .emacs file a line
(setq flyspell-mode t)
It does not seem to work.
To have flyspell work I have to do:
M-x flyspell-mode twice - first time is says "Loading
flyspell...done"; second time it says "Starting new Ispell process..."
(1) What shall I do to make .emacs turn on flyspell?
(2) How can I avoid typing the M-x flyspell-mode twice (in case 1
does not work)?
